Image

Megaman 9

XBLA sales roundup: Deal of the Week, publisher sales & more
11 years ago

XBLA sales roundup: Deal of the Week, publisher sales & more

This week on the marketplace, the Sales & Specials area is filled with a variety of sales for gamers of all kinds. From an Assassins Creed themed sale to …
Read More